Transaction 31f7697fa58a686c9199b5da9cf706a17e0424223a59dc331ac6ea52e9f27f3b
1 Input
1 Output
-
31f7697fa58a686c9199b5da9cf706a17e0424223a59dc331ac6ea52e9f27f3b:0
- value
- 140257
- script pubkey
- OP_0 OP_PUSHBYTES_20 e436b6123eb24b5fbcb645e945f17c980e1681ea
- address
- bc1qusmtvy37kf94l09kgh55tutunq8pdq029skzqp